Transmission

Reports naming the automatic or manual transmission, including shifting behaviour, shudder, slipping and transmission control modules.

2
reports

From owner reports, verbatim

MY 2009 SUBARU IMPREZA OUTBACK SPORT. FAILURE OF BEARINGS IN 5-SPEED MANUAL TRANSMISSION 6 MONTHS AFTER PURCHASE OF VEHICLE. MADE OPERATION OF VEHICLE DANGEROUS, AND REQUIRES ENTIRE REBUILD OF TRANSMISSION, TAKING 3 WEEKS. *TR

NHTSA ID 10353974 · filed Sep 6, 2010

A RETAINING RING IN THE CENTER DIFFERENTIAL ASSEMBLY FAILED, CAUSING GEAR DAMAGE AND REQUIRING THE REPLACEMENT OF THE CENTER DIFFERENTIAL ASSEMBLY AN ALL OF THE BEARINGS IN THE TRANSMISSION. THIS WAS COVERED BY WARRANTY REPAIR BUT WAS A CONCERNING FAILURE AT THIS LOW MILEAGE. I HAVE HEARD OTHER REPORTS OF SUBARU OWNERS HAVING SIMILAR PROBLEMS. *TR

NHTSA ID 10314169 · filed Feb 25, 2010

Engine

Reports naming the engine itself — including stalling, misfires, oil consumption, cooling and internal engine components.

1
report

From owner reports, verbatim

SUBARU OUTBACK SPORTS 2009 MODEL, WITH NO PRIOR HISTORY PROBLEM EXCEPT THAT SUBARU RECALLED AN ELECTRONIC BOARD AND IT WAS REPLACED BY SUBARU DEALER. JUST GOT OFF THE HIGHWAY, COMING FROM THE AIRPORT, SMELLED SOMETHING BURNING LIKE WOOD. OPENED THE WINDOW TO MAKE SURE IT IS NOT OUR CAR. SMELL WAS STILL THERE. PULLED OFF THE ROAD. CHECK ENGINE LIGHT WENT ON, LOTS OF SMOKE FROM HOOD AFTER ONE SECOND THE FIRE STARTED ENGULFING THE HOOD. MY HUSBAND AND I JUMPED OUT OF THE CAR OF FEAR OF AN EXPLOSION AND CALLED 911 RIGHT AWAY. WITHIN 7 MINUTES ABOUT THE CAR WAS COMPLETELY BURNT. FIRE DEPARTMENT CAME WITHIN 10 MINUTES WHILE CAR WAS STILL BURNING., LOST SOME ELECTRONIC GADGETS, CAMERA, TABLET, 2 GPS, ETC., AND SOME CLOTHING AND ODDS AND ENDS BUT EVERYONE WAS SAFE. . THE WOMEN FROM THE CLAIM DEPARTMENT SAID THAT SHE ALSO HAD CALL ABOUT A FIRE IN A SUBARU COMING FROM THE AIRPORT LIKE US. SHE DID NOT WANT TO SAY ANYMORE SINCE SHE ACCIDENTALLY SAID IT. SUBARU REFUSE TO INVESTIGATE THE FIRE UNLESS I PUT A CLAIM AGAINST THEM. *TR

NHTSA ID 10565996 · filed Feb 26, 2014
